Comprehending Bail Bonds
In the lawful process, bail bonds work as a crucial system that enables people charged with criminal activities to protect their release from guardianship while awaiting trial. A bail bond is basically a monetary assurance provided by a 3rd party, typically a bond bondsman, which makes certain that the charged will certainly appear in court at the designated times. When a court establishes a bond quantity, it mirrors the seriousness of the charges and the regarded trip threat of the offender.
Individuals who can not manage the full bail quantity may transform to bondsman, who charge a non-refundable charge, normally around 10% of the total bail. This charge makes up the bail bondsman for assuming the danger of the defendant possibly failing to appear in court. If the accused does not follow court appearances, the bondsman might use various approaches to locate and capture the person.

Alternatives to Bail Bonds
Many alternatives to traditional bail bonds exist within the legal structure, each offering special mechanisms for pretrial launch. One such choice is release on recognizance (ROR), where defendants pledge to show up in court without the need for monetary bail. This choice is typically available to individuals regarded low-risk, promoting justness in the justice system.
An additional choice is making use of monitored release programs, which involve checking defendants with check-ins with a pretrial solutions officer. These programs may incorporate conditions how much of your bail do you pay such as curfews or digital tracking, making certain conformity and minimizing trip danger.
In addition, some jurisdictions execute diversion programs that concentrate on recovery instead of revengeful steps. Defendants may get involved in social work or counseling as a condition of their release, attending to underlying concerns while minimizing incarceration.
Finally, bail funds established by not-for-profit organizations provide monetary help to low-income defendants, allowing them to safeguard launch without the burden of high costs related to typical bail bonds.
